I purchased a Touch to use in a listening area dedicated to headphones. 
I found myself controlling the Touch more through my iPod than through
the Touch's touchscreen.  So, I decided to move the Touch into our main
listening area in the family room and took the SB3 that was there and
used that in my headphone setup.

It's worked out much better in the family room.  The touch screen gets
used more often since you just walk up to it.  Being a little smaller
and newer, it has a more up-to-date look.  My kids use it all of the
time and really find the touch interface intuitive.

I would say get a Touch and put it in your main listening area and
relegate your SB3 to less demanding duties, perhaps attached to some
powered speakers.
